**N Butanol Market End-User Industry Insights**

N-butanol is a four-carbon alcohol with a variety of applications across various end-user industries. Its unique properties, such as high solvent power, low toxicity and renewability, make it a sustainable alternative to traditional petroleum-based solvents. The automotive industry is a major consumer of N-Butanol, utilizing it as a fuel additive, solvent and cleaner. The growing demand for fuel-efficient and environmentally friendly vehicles is expected to drive the consumption of N-butanol in this sector.

The chemical industry also represents a significant market for N-Butanol, as it is used as an intermediate in the production of various chemicals, including plasticizers, synthetic rubbers and detergents.The textile industry utilizes N-Butanol as a solvent for dyeing and finishing processes. Its ability to effectively remove impurities and enhance fabric quality makes it a valuable component in the textile manufacturing process. The pharmaceutical industry also employs N-Butanol in the production of pharmaceuticals, such as antibiotics and vitamins. Its low toxicity and biodegradability contribute to its suitability for use in the healthcare sector.

Other end-user industries, such as food and beverage, personal care and agriculture, also contribute to the demand for N-Butanol.Its antimicrobial properties make it a useful additive in food preservation, while its mild solvent properties find applications in personal care products and agricultural formulations. The increasing awareness of sustainability and the need for eco-friendly alternatives are expected to further drive the growth of the N-Butanol market in these industries.

**N Butanol Market Regional Insights**

The regional segmentation of the N Butanol Market provides insights into the market's distribution across different geographic regions. North America, Europe, APAC, South America, and MEA are the key regions analyzed in this segment. In 2023, North America held a dominant position in the N Butanol Market, accounting for approximately 40.6% of the global revenue. This dominance is attributed to the region's well-established chemical industry and growing demand for N Butanol in various industries.

Europe is another significant region in the market, capturing around 34.7% of the global revenue in 2023.The presence of major chemical manufacturers and the stringent environmental regulations driving the adoption of bio-based chemicals contribute to Europe's growth. The APAC region is expected to witness substantial growth in the coming years, driven by the increasing demand for N Butanol in emerging economies such as China and India. The growing pharmaceutical and automotive industries in these countries are fueling the demand for N Butanol.
